While we need to transition to greener vehicles as soon as possible, it’s still going to take a few decades. In the meantime, finding other ways to slurp up that air pollution is important, so why not turn to the most common building material in the world to help? In recent years scientists have developed concrete that can convert some of the nasties in the surrounding air into harmless products.

Sand in a desert dune demonstrating a similar type of landslide called retrogressive where failure forms at the bottom, progressing up a slope. Due to the absence of cohesion and shape of the grains, this phenomenon is possible in sands.

Sensitive clays are known for producing retrogressive landslides, also called spread or flowslides. The key characteristics associated with the occurrence of these landslides on a sensitive clay slope must be evaluated, and the potential retrogressive distance must be evaluated.

Retrogressive landslides in sensitive clays often occur following a single major perturbation, such as an earthquake, or they may occur after a large number of annual load cycles at a geological time scale, with the final trigger related to a minor and seemingly innocuous perturbation. These failure events can therefore occur without any obvious warning signs. The potential retrogressive distance of these landslides can also reach values much greater than 100 m. This uncertainty in their behavior emphasizes the importance of determining where these landslides can occur.

The American company Migo Robotics has developed a robot vacuum cleaner that can walk on steps. The Ascender vacuum cleaner was created by a team of engineers from Google, Boston Dynamics, Dyson, and Ecovacs.

A pair of articulated legs lifts the body of the robot up the steps as it moves up the stairs. In doing so, the Ascender continues to clean. The assistant is also equipped with omnidirectional wheels for moving on a flat surface.

And Migo Robotics used LiDAR to map the room and track the cleaning route.

Solid-state batteries have a lot of promise. Unlike current lithium-ion batteries, solid-state ones don't contain flammable liquids, which are a major drawback as illustrated by stories of laptops and electric cars bursting into flames. Solid-state batteries are also less toxic, have higher energy densities, charge faster, and survive more recharge cycles without degenerating.

GPS uses a network of a few dozen satellites in precise orbits around Earth, and receivers in devices like phones are constantly listening out for signals from those satellites. The devices can work out how far they are from any detected GPS satellite, and when they pick up signals from at least four of them, the device can determine its relative position on the ground to within a few meters.
And now Scientists have demonstrated a proof-of-concept for a new navigation system that can work underground and underwater by tracking particles from cosmic rays

How the Sun illuminates the Earth throughout the year. The video consists of 365 frames, 1 frame for each day of the year. The pictures were taken at the same time. Data from Eumetsat satellite. Credit: Simon Proud
